'Tell her I'll come back to her; tell her I'll find a way.' Ireland, Autumn 1845.
The potato blight turns green fields black overnight. A million will die. A million more will flee. But Liam O'Donaghue refuses to watch his family starve. In the shadow of Galway's cliffs, Liam has carved out a life training Connemara ponies while working on his landlord's estate and loving his wife Máire. When their newborn son arrives, their happiness seems complete. But when the Great Famine strikes with merciless fury, survival becomes the only currency that matters.
One desperate night. One choice that changes everything.
Torn from the only world he's ever known, Liam must find his way across unforgiving landscapes, oceans and continents. From the desperation of the famine, where a man's life is worth less than a bag of grain, to the abundance of Australian gold rushes, where he meets his friend Kumba. Together, they journey onward to the California gold rushes, chasing fortune and the hope of return. Meanwhile, Máire faces her own battle to keep their son alive in a land where hope itself has withered. From the green hills of Connemara to shores unknown, this is the story of love tested by impossible odds and the fierce determination of the Irish heart.
An epic historical saga of survival, sacrifice and the unbreakable bonds of family.

    Lucy Maud Montgomery (November 30, 1874 – April 24, 1942), published as L. M. Montgomery, was a Canadian author best known for a series of novels beginning in 1908 with Anne of Green Gables. The book was an immediate success. The title character, orphan Anne Shirley, made Montgomery famous in her lifetime and gave her an international following.
